virus don't bread rather each HCV RNA molecule is copied by the RNA-dependent RNA polymerase and the nucleic acid sequence of RNA strands serves as template for generating new viral genomes.



Yes, I know. I was using "cross breed" as a short cut expression to express the concept of what happens when 2 virions get into the same cell and everything goes just right (or wrong) and they swap a few stretches of RNA/DNA. The same process over which there was a bunch of hand-wringing during the recent Avian Flu scare.

PS I was too lazy to look up a generally accepted scientific nomenclature - but FWIW one appears to be 'hybridization'.
